What is the largest energy storage plant based on vanadium flow batteries?
The battery installation, which received funding from the SOLBAL photovoltaic investment aid programme, managed by IDAE, has a power of 1.1 MW and a storage capacity of 5.5 MWh, making it the largest energy storage plant based on vanadium flow batteries in Europe.
Why is vanadium a promising LDEs solution?
Vanadium contributes to decarbonising hard-to-abate sectors. VRFBs are a promising LDES solution because of their scalability, full depth of discharge, ability to cycle frequently and for long durations, non-flammable construction, and the recyclable nature of the electrolyte. 2.
Are vfbs a 'working' reserve of vanadium?
For regions where vanadium consumption far exceeds production, which is true of most of North America, Europe, Japan, India, and East Asia, VFBs can serve as “working” reserves of vanadium while realizing the functionality of energy storage.
